2、How often should a driver who is more than 60 years old present the certificate of physical conditions?
A. every 3 years
B. every 2 years
C. every 6 months
D. every 1 year
Answer:D

7、When driving in thick or extremely thick fog, the driver should ____ due to low visibility.
A. Turn on the head light and keep driving
B. Turn on the contour light, fog light and drive along the right side
C. Turn on the hazard lights and keep driving
D. Turn on the hazard lights, fog light, and stop at a safe place
Answer:D

12、When driving a vehicle through an inundated road with pedestrians on both sides, the driver should ________.
A. Speed up and pass
B. Go forward normally
C. Continuously honk
D. Reduce speed and go slowly
Answer:D
13、When a vehicle approaches a bus stopping at a bus stop, the driver should ______ in case the bus starts up suddenly or pedestrians cross in front of the bus.
A. Reduce speed, keep a sufficient distance and be ready to stop anytime
B. Maintain the normal speed
C. Honk to remind, speed up and pass
D. Be ready to apply emergency braking
Answer:A

20、If the registration paper, license plate and vehicle license of a motorized vehicle are lost or destroyed, the vehicle owner should apply for reissuing or replacing them to the _______________.
A. traffic police detachment vehicle management station at the residential place
B. vehicle management station at the issuing place of the driving license
C. vehicle management station at the registration place
D. local police station
Answer:C
